Concussion is now a powder-keg issue in world sport as concerns deepen about the potential links to brain disease.
The long-terms effects of a career spent making and taking heavy tackles are being revealed in ever-increasing detail, but the risks are not exclusive to so-called full contact sports.
Some governing bodies have spring into action, implementing new rules and safety measures. But others turn a blind eye.
So, we’re asking – how will the concussion issue effect the future of sport?
